Firefox regularly freezes for a minute or more, mostly in gmail

Firefox sometimes freezes for one or two minutes. During this time it doesn't respond to anything. It uses a little over 100% CPU (one of four cores) during this time, and around 1GB memory. I don't get a "stop script" message. No other programs I use have this behavior.

This is rare except in Gmail, where it happens every 10 minutes, often when moving the text cursor by clicking somewhere in an email I'm typing.

I use Firefox 40.0.3 on Ubuntu 14.04. I just tried and the problem also happens in safe mode, although the two freezes encountered were short (seconds instead of a minute). Normally I use several addons, mostly very popular ones not specifically related to Gmail/Google. I often have ~10-15 (pinned) tabs open, though I didn't in safe mode.

I already deleted my profile, then synced on a clean profile.
